How To make a new Dimenion Style?

Carlos Molina
Newcomer
I just want to make a Custom dim style with a default Custom text. I know how to modify a dim style but I cannot find the way to add the custom text on it-

Carlos wrote:
As always thanks for your reply Laszo.
But what I really need is something that when I make the dimensions already has the "Custom Value" I want... it is really inefficient to do it one by one.
I mean, if I going to dimension the Opening, just have a Custom Dim Style with the "DLO" text. Do you know what I mean?

The problem is you need to select the text portion of the dimension to customise it.
You can't customise the text from the dimension settings (apart from basic font styles/size) and the text does not have its own tool settings until it is placed and selected.
So you can't pre-set any defaults for the customised text.

But still the problem will be that you probably want this default for only single dimensions.
With a string of dimensions you would probably want to edit one or two in which case you would just select the text you want to change.

You can select the Dimension Text, then in the Info Box, switch from "Measure Value" to "Custom Value" in the Settings Dialog, and modify the text to whatever you need.
